Patent number: 4783050Abstract: A magnetic valve for liquid and gaseous media having a flatbody slide valve which can slide with the aid of electromagnetic force between two planar-parallel slide surfaces. The slide surfaces include control openings. The slide valve comprises a core polarized by at least one stationary permanent magnet with at least one opening in the core being perpendicular to the planar-parallel slide surfaces. A pressure chamber is formed in the core with ends at both sides of the chamber. A cover surface borders an end wall of the chamber. At least two pair of corresponding control openings are inversely disposed. A connection bore having an opening at either end is in fluid communication with the pressure chamber. The edges of the bore openings serve to form control edges for the at least two pairs of control openings.Type: GrantFiled: June 19, 1987Date of Patent: November 8, 1988Assignee: ASYS GmbHInventor: Klaus Hugler

Patent number: 4574841Abstract: A solenoid-operated pressure-fluid valve for reversible control of both supply and exhaust functions of a double-acting fluid-pressure device. A valve body has an inlet port communicating with an inlet chamber and an exhaust-outlet port communicating with an outlet chamber. The valve body has first and second control-port connections for connection to the respective control ports of the double-acting device, and each of these connections communicates with a valve seat in each of the chambers. A rocker arm is pivoted between the two chambers and carries two valve members in each of the two chambers.Type: GrantFiled: September 20, 1984Date of Patent: March 11, 1986Assignee: J. Patent number: 4561632Abstract: A solenoid valve for liquid and gaseous media whose valve closure piece or pieces (24) can be actuated by an armature (20') which is movable relative to the valve seat or seats (18, 19) is disclosed. The armature lies in the magnetic field of at least one electromagnet (4, 5) and of at least one permanent magnet (10) arranged outside the field of the electromagnet. The valve is closed via the armature (20') and has operating air gaps which change in opposite directions upon a movement of the armature. The electromagnet is provided with a core (4) whose ends form three magnet poles (10, 11, 12). The armature (20') which contains the permanent magnet (21) has two pole pieces (20') which extend between the three magnet poles (10, 11, 12) of the electromagnet to form four operating air gaps, the pole pieces being combined with the permanent magnet and connected with them to form as assembly.Type: GrantFiled: September 20, 1984Date of Patent: December 31, 1985Assignee: J.
